CSU could miss the Oct. 19 deadline for its COVID update

CSU might miss its Oct. 19 deadline for a decision on a COVID-19 vaccine mandate, the faculty senate learned at its second meeting for the fall 2021 semester. Separately, President Sands highlighted Ohio House Bill 327, which would prohibit teaching, advocating or promoting divisive concepts in schools that receive state funds.

MEDIA DAY: Men’s basketball enters new season with team three and a blank canvas

Cleveland State men's basketball held its media day at the Wolstein Center on Thursday afternoon. The Vikings are coming off last year's historic run where they won the Horizon League and clinched their third ever berth in the NCAA tournament. They will look to block out the hype after being picked to finish first in the Horizon League preseason poll.

Vikings score slam dunk with VIKEtober Basketball Showcase

Cleveland State introduced its fans to the 2021-2022 basketball teams during the VIKEtober Basketball Showcase at the Wolstein Center on Friday evening. The event featured complimentary giveaways, free food, on-court activities and drew nearly 1,000 people, according to CSU athletics.

Dr. Faison reflects on his 18 months at Cleveland State University

Dr. Forrest Faison will leave his position as Vice President of Research, Innovation and Healthcare Strategy in October. He sat down with the Cleveland Stater to talk about his time here, including his role on the Pandemic Response team. “What’s going to make the campus safe is people getting vaccinated,” Faison said.
